system advice

I have a 1999 standard cab f150. I'm thinkin about putting in a small system. Right now I only have a crappy pair of pioneer speakers. I think I want to put in two 10" subs, a better pair of speakers, a new head unit, and an amp. I've got 8 or 9 inches behind the seat to put the subs in and found some cheap truck boxes that would fit. I'm lookin to spend around 200 on the subs, 200 on the head unit (hopefully mp3), and get a decent amp. I've looked around this forum and found a lot of different opinions, rockford, infinity etc... any suggestions?

tried to post last night but FTE gave me a server busy error so i had time to look for a few mp3 players. if u can up ur budget to about $300, u have a lot of choices. here are the ones i found:
Pioneer DEH-P4500MP - $199
Pioneer DEH-P5500MP - $239
Kenwood KCD-MP522 - $249
Alpine CDA-9807 - $297
Alpine CDA-9811 - $329

i suggest the one of the alpines, i have one and its such a nice unit with many features, if u just wanna base line MP3 player then go with the cheap pioneer. stay away from AWIA, Sony Xplod and Jensen MP3 players (well Jensen and Xplod anything)

as far as the subs, i would suggest one 10" sub, which will be plenty of bass to fill the cab and still get u more space. id take a look at the K series from Elemental Designs (www.edsignaudio.com), the new Pioneer subs look promising also, as do Infinity Reference or Alpine Type-S.

for speakers, component speakers would be a good option or a good set of co-triaxles (2=co/3=triway). Pioneer makes good speakers, so does Infinity, MB Quart, Boston Acoustics...just to name a few...if u wanna go the comp. set route then Diamonds M3 line, Infinity Reference, MB Quart...
